We have just the 2 domains on a dedicated server - Pets Classifieds and Aquarist Classifieds.

When at peak time there is a very heavy demand on the whole website because of so many visitors (mostly looking at the adverts) some pages do load a bit slowly because of demands on the databases. The forum loads slowly as there are multiple database calls per page.

I am scratching my head for solutions, it may mean moving to a faster server.
